Who wrote a book about heavenly bodies that eventually revolutionized how people pictured the placement of earth within the universe?
1 answer
Nicolaus Copernicus wrote the book De revolutionibus orbium coelestium (On the Revolutions of the Celestial Spheres), which revolutionized how people pictured the placement of earth within the universe.
